-
Notifications
You must be signed in to change notification settings - Fork 51
/
riak-0.3.txt
33 lines (25 loc) · 1.2 KB
/
riak-0.3.txt
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
riak-0.3
This release includes a backwards-incompatible change to riak_object,
enforcing all object keys to be binaries. This only effects users of
the Erlang native interface. Users of the HTTP/Jiak interface should
not be affected.
riak_object:
- Enforcement of binary-only object keys.
HTTP Interface:
- new Java client.
- HTTP results now include Link: headers (http://tools.ietf.org/html/draft-nottingham-http-link-header-06).
- Upgraded to Webmachine-1.4 and mochiweb-trunk.
- Fixed default web access log directory.
Eventer:
- Performance improvements (only calculate eventers on ring-state changes).
- Add a local logfile facility via the riak_local_logfile configuration
parameter. This should only be used for debugging as the profuse logging
can compete with the I/O demands of Riak itself.
Internals:
- Fix for a ring-state gossip bug encountered when running large clusters.
- Increased value of ERL_MAX_PORTS to 4096 to support larger ring sizes.
Performance:
- Turn riak_bucketkeys into a gen_server2 process with tuned GC parameters.
- Enable kernel-poll in Erlang VM by default.
Documentation:
- Documented all configuration parameters in config/riak.erlenv